Abstract
A system and method for monitoring pedestrians based upon information is collected by a wide array of sensors already included in modern motor vehicles. Also included, is a system of monitoring pedestrians by aggregating data collected by an array of vehicles.

7. A method for monitoring pedestrian health comprising:
-
acquiring, by a vehicle computer of a vehicle, a plurality of thermal images of a pedestrian sidewalk from one or more thermal imagers as the vehicle is driving on a roadway located adjacent the pedestrian sidewalk; acquiring, by the vehicle computer, a plurality of high definition images of the pedestrian sidewalk from one or more high definition imagers as the vehicle is driving on the roadway located adjacent the pedestrian sidewalk, determining, by the vehicle computer, whether the plurality of thermal images and the plurality of high definition images contain one or more pedestrians on the pedestrian sidewalk, determining, based on the plurality of thermal images and the plurality of high definition images contain the one or more pedestrians on the pedestrian sidewalk, whether a pedestrian of the one or more pedestrians who was previously walking on the pedestrian sidewalk is falling or lying on the pedestrian sidewalk and exhibiting an injured pedestrian behavior, selectively displaying, by the vehicle computer, an alert on a display communicatively coupled to the vehicle computer in response to determining the pedestrian is falling or lying on the pedestrian sidewalk; and selectively transmitting, via a real time interface of the vehicle computer, the plurality of thermal images and the plurality of high definition images to a database server in response to determining that the pedestrian is falling or lying on the pedestrian sidewalk. - View Dependent Claims (8, 9, 10, 11, 12)
